Charlie Cochet has marked her ability with a slam dunk hit series THIRDS…..It has taken off so quickly to be a favorite of many readers. But, this is not going to be a one shot deal for this girl. Now, for your reading enjoyment, Ms Cochet has given us a Halloween spook-tac-ular ; certainly a story with a different feel, a change from the Therian- Human world she has already created. Between the Devil and Pacific Blue will keep you riveted to your seats , written with a hint of glamour about a hotel, a security guard, where the past and present meet……

Detective James Ralston has worked the nightshift as security guard at the old Pacific Blue Hotel. This elegant old girl had been the cat’s meow in its heyday. The walls are still covered in tapestries, the rugs are worn. At night James makes his rounds and we find him in the early hours going to the radio room, meeting with a handsome guest Franklin Fairchild.

I picture these scenes Ms. Cochet described are out of a black and white movie with the music playing from a gramophone as these two men get closer and closer. I do not want to spoil the story or the ending, I will say it is a wonderful story which Ms Cochet departs from her normal writing and shows us something different.
